Output 03ab50c95a647dd969533f113c45c4bc773e0e1c3759e229f23dbb09fb04de84:1

value
29000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8bbf7593595f000bffc67a46a05440aff3ecae3 OP_EQUAL
address
3JXoRxiWbEKqubkZjHy33WPHTLrVF5Lqif
transaction
03ab50c95a647dd969533f113c45c4bc773e0e1c3759e229f23dbb09fb04de84
spent
true